What kind of ABS system does a Pontiac use?

Bosch ABS modules are commonly found in 2000-era Pontiac and other General Motors vehicles. Pontiacs use Bosch 5.3 and 5.4 anti-lock brake systems. A failed module on a General Motors vehicle will produce all or some of the following: ABS warning light, TCS off warning light, PCS warning light, and DTC error code C0550.

What does the ABS light on a car mean?

The ABS Light is on. The most common sign of an issue with the ABS system is the ABS Light coming on. The ABS Light will show an amber color, and is the equivalent of a Check Engine Light, except it is only to diagnose problems with the ABS system.

Where is the anti lock brake relay on a Pontiac Grand Am?

If your car is a 2000 or newer you might find the anti lock brake relay underneath the battery tray along the left frame rail of the car. If you go to auto zone they will plug the code scanner into your car for free.
